The Big Swap details

Format: 18 DVD
Starring: Julie-Ann Gillitt, Mark Adams, Richard Cherry, Sorcha Brooks, Alison Egan, Mark Caven
Director: Niall Johnson
Genre: Drama - General

  • Entertaining

    Rated - 3.0 stars  
    By a customer from Stonehouse , 16 Mar 2009
    This is at about the level of a reasonable channel 4 toungue-in-cheek drama, its no porno romp, so don't expect too much flesh. It involves the switching of emphases in relationships, that are often too much for individuals to bear, a common theme in adult drama, and its repeated here. It quels no myths and supports no stereotypes and so should not threaten any broad minded watcher. Have fun.

  • The Big … oh, actually it’s not bad.

    Rated - 3.0 stars  
    By RiffRaff (112 reviews) from Heywood , 10 Sep 2008
    More than a bit contrived to start with but it got better. There were some interesting characters explored, each with their own demons, dilemmas and compromises – definitely the most interesting aspect. When I saw the DVD menu I rolled my eyes and thought I had rented a crummy skin-flick – and there was a fair bit of skin on show - but it was worth persevering and in the end I was pleasantly surprised by the film. The start and end were pretty lame but the middle sections were good. Slightly surprised that I’ve not seen any of the actors in anything else.
